Maison >Java >javaDidacticiel >Comment puis-je me connecter et utiliser des bases de données SQLite avec Java ?
Java et SQLite : un guide de connexion et d'utilisation
Dans la recherche d'une solution de base de données plus efficace et plus compacte, SQLite s'est imposé comme un choix populaire. Cet article explore les options disponibles pour connecter et utiliser SQLite avec le langage de programmation Java.
Le choix pratique : JavaSQLite
L'une des principales bibliothèques permettant d'interfacer Java avec SQLite est JavaSQLite. . Ce wrapper léger fournit une API intuitive qui simplifie les interactions avec la base de données. En ajoutant simplement le fichier JAR JavaSQLite au chemin de classe de votre projet, vous pouvez vous connecter aux bases de données SQLite et effectuer diverses opérations.
Une solution directe : JDBC
Pour une solution plus directe approche, envisagez d’utiliser le pilote Java JDBC pour SQLite. Ce pilote vous permet d'interagir avec les bases de données SQLite à l'aide de l'API JDBC familière. Vous pouvez ajouter le fichier sqlitejdbc-v056.jar à votre chemin de classe et importer les packages java.sql.* nécessaires.
Un exemple pratique
Pour démontrer la facilité d'utilisation avec le pilote JDBC, considérez cet extrait de code Java :
import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.Statement; public class Test { public static void main(String[] args) throws Exception { Class.forName("org.sqlite.JDBC"); Connection conn = DriverManager.getConnection("jdbc:sqlite:test.db"); Statement stat = conn.createStatement(); ... } }
Ce code illustre comment se connecter à une base de données SQLite, créez une table, insérez des données et effectuez une requête. Le fichier de base de données test.db sera créé dans le répertoire racine du projet, offrant un moyen simple et pratique de travailler avec une base de données locale.
Ressources supplémentaires
Pour en savoir plus Pour plus d'informations sur l'intégration Java et SQLite, consultez les ressources suivantes :
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!